Scottish universities ‘will attract £3bn for collaborative research’

Report finds universities will also contribute £400 million for regeneration projects over next five years

Universities in Scotland will attract more than £3 billion in funding for collaborative research projects over the next five years, according to a report. 

Getting Results for Scotland was published on 28 June by the vice-chancellor’s group Universities Scotland, and is based on analysis by the National Centre for Entrepreneurship in Education.
